With MediaMonkey 3 I was able to enable the column browser for the Music node of the tree, and it was always visible until I disabled it. That doesn't seem to be the case with MediaMonkey 4. If I enable the column browser when I'm at the Music node and then switch to the Now Playing node, the browser disappears as expected. However, when I go back to the Music node, it doesn't re-appear. Is there any way to get it to do so, or is this a bug?

This is a bug, it appears that the column browser does persist between switching nodes, but when you bring the Now Playing node into view, then the column browser always disappears.

When the Column Browser loses persistence, MM also resets the Video Column Browser column list to the Music Column Browser column list. The Video settings are lost. To recreate...
1. Make the Music and Video Column Browser columns different.
2. Click Now Playing.
3. Return to the Video Column Browser.
4. The Video Column Browser columns have been replaced by the Music Column Browser columns.
